"Μένω εμβρόντητος ακούγοντάς σας ν' αναφέρεστε σ' ένα τόσο διεστραμμένο βιβλίο. Λυπάμαι που ομολογείτε ότι το διαβάσατε - καμία αξιοπρεπής κυρία δε θα 'πρεπε να παραδέχεται κάτι τέτοιο. Είναι το πιο διεφθαρμένο έργο που ξέρω". Μ' αυτά τα λόγια εκφράζει ο Σάμιουελ Τζόνσον στη Χάνα Μορ την άποψή του για τον "Τομ Τζόουνς", έργο που για δύο περίπου αιώνες ξεσήκωσε αναρίθμητα και ποικίλα σχόλια, φτάνοντας μάλιστα και στο σημείο να θεωρηθεί, από αρκετούς, υπεύθυνο για τους σεισμούς τον Λονδίνου το 1749, σημάδι της οργής του Κυρίου απέναντι στον ...

Fielding's comic masterpiece of 1749 was immediately attacked as `A motley history of bastardism, fornication, and adultery'. Indeed, his populous novel overflows with a marvellous assortment of prudes, whores, libertines, bumpkins, misanthropes, hypocrites, scoundrels, virgins, and all too fallible humanitarians. At the centre of one of the most ingenious plots in English fiction stands a hero whose actions were, in 1749, as shocking as they are funny today. Both Joseph Andrews (1742) and Shamela (1741) were prompted by the success of Richardson's Pamela (1740), of which Shamela is a splendidly bawdy parody. But in Shamela Fielding also demonstrates his concern for the corruption of contemporary society, politics, religion, morality, and taste. The same themes - together with a presentation of love as charity, as friendship, and in its sexual taste - are present in Joseph Andrews, Fielding's first novel. The real-life Jonathan Wild, gangland godfather and self-styled 'Thieftaker General', controlled much of the London underworld until he was executed for his crimes in 1725. Even during his lifetime his achievements attracted attention; after his death balladeers sang of his exploits, and satirists made connections between his success and the triumph of corruption in high places. With its combination of satire and sentiment, its focus on the seedy side of London life, and its unexpected shifts in tone, Amelia has intrigued and disturbed readers since its first publication. Eagerly awaited by Henry Fielding's eighteenth-century readers of Tom Jones, the novel perplexed many of them.
